Types of Doors
Doors come in various styles and products, each serving a various function. Here is a breakdown of some typical types of doors:
1. Outside Doors
Outside doors are the first line of defense against the components and burglars. They are usually made from strong products to guarantee security and insulation.
Fiberglass Doors: Durable and energy-efficient, fiberglass doors can mimic the look of wood while supplying much better resistance to weather elements. Steel Doors: These doors use high security and are resistant to fire and weathering. They are typically utilized in business settings but can likewise appropriate for property homes.Wood Doors: While they provide a beautiful appearance, they need more maintenance to avoid warping and damage from moisture.2. Interior Doors
Interior doors are usually lighter and designed to supply privacy in between rooms.
Hollow-Core Doors: Cost-effective and lightweight, they are typically utilized in property applications.Solid-Core Doors: These are heavier and supply better sound insulation, making them ideal for bedrooms and bathrooms.Sliding Doors: Ideal for saving space, they can function as room dividers or as closet doors.3. Specialty Doors
These doors serve specific functions and can add unique features to a home.
French Doors: These are made of glass panes within a frame, providing a stylish entry to outdoor patios or gardens while letting in light.Bi-Fold Doors: These doors fold back against themselves, making them a great option for big openings like patio areas or balconies. Storm Doors: Additional protective doors installed outside main entryways to supply extra insulation and security.Types of Windows
Like doors, windows come in numerous types, products, and styles. The option of window can affect a home's energy performance, natural light, and aesthetic appeal.
1. Fixed Windows
Fixed windows do not open and are generally used to offer unblocked views and natural light.
2. Operable Windows
These are windows that can be opened for ventilation.
Double-Hung Windows: Featuring 2 movable sashes that move up and down, these are versatile and enable airflow.Casement Windows: Hinged at one side and crank-open, they offer excellent ventilation and are frequently more energy-efficient than other types.Sliding Windows: These windows include two or more sashes that move horizontally.3. Specialty Windows
Specialized windows consist of special shapes or styles that can improve the architectural aesthetics of a structure.
Bay Windows: Composed of three or more windows that extend beyond the exterior wall, they produce additional space and a scenic view.Bow Windows: Similar to bay windows but with a curved design, they generally consist of four or more windows.Materials: The Backbone of Doors and Windows
The materials used in windows and doors influence their toughness, maintenance requirements, and insulation homes. Here are common products:

The life expectancy differs by product, however usually:
Wood doors: 15-30 years Steel doors: 20 years Vinyl windows: 20-40 yearsHow can I make my windows more energy-efficient?
Setting up double-glazed or triple-glazed windows, including window movies, and utilizing good-quality weather condition removing can substantially improve energy efficiency.
Do I require a license to install brand-new doors or windows?
Inspect local structure codes, as licenses may be needed, specifically for structural changes.
What is a door's R-value, and why is it crucial?
The R-value determines thermal resistance, showing how well a door or window can insulate. A greater R-value indicates better insulation and energy effectiveness.
